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of injection mold technology, and specifically to a guide device for precision molds. Background Technology
[0002] A guide device for precision molds refers to a device specifically designed for use in precision molds to ensure that the mold can be accurately aligned and operate stably during mold closing, mold opening, stamping and other processes, and to protect the mold and stamping equipment. This guide device plays a vital role in mold manufacturing and stamping processes. It can improve the accuracy, stability and service life of the mold, while reducing production and maintenance costs.
[0003] A search revealed that Chinese utility model patent CN213919357U discloses an injection mold guiding device. This device uses a slider and guide rod for sliding connection, allowing the moving mold to slide up and down in a certain direction. This significantly reduces the likelihood of the moving mold deviating from the fixed mold during mold closing. Furthermore, a first buffer spring provides vertical cushioning. A falling insert plate into a slot causes two buffer blocks to move in a separating direction, compressing the second buffer spring and further reducing the impact force between the moving and fixed molds during mold closing, thus extending the equipment's lifespan.
[0004] However, in actual use, the continuous mold injection and repeated contact and friction between the guide post and the guide groove can easily cause the guide post to deform due to friction, affecting the accuracy of mold alignment and shortening the service life of the guide post. [0028] Please see Figures 1-5 As shown, this utility model is a guide device for precision molds, including an upper module 1 and a lower module 2. A guide post 3 is fixedly installed on the lower surface of the upper module 1. The lower module 2 is located below the upper module 1. A mold cavity 5 and a guide groove 4 are opened on the upper surface of the lower module 2. An extrusion component is installed inside the guide groove 4. The guide groove 4 is connected to a transfer pipe 17. The transfer pipe 17 is connected to a cavity 10. A first control component is installed at one end of the transfer pipe 17 near the upper module 1. The first control component includes a first spring 15 fixedly installed on the transfer pipe 17. The first spring 15 is fixedly connected to a first rotating block 16. The first rotating block 16 is rotatably connected to the transfer pipe 17. The cavity 10 is connected to an oil injection pipe 9. A second control component is installed inside the oil injection pipe 9.
[0029] The working principle of the precision mold guiding device proposed in this utility model is as follows: the raw material is placed into the mold cavity 5, and then the upper module 1 is squeezed to make the upper module 1 and the lower module 2 fit together completely, so that the guide post 3 can smoothly enter the guide groove 4 opened on the surface of the lower module 2 to complete one molding. During this process, the guide post 3 transmits pressure to the extrusion assembly. The extrusion assembly compresses the space inside the cavity 10. Under the continuous pressure, the lubricant inside the cavity 10 will flow along the transfer pipe 17 and squeeze the first rotating block 16 in the first control assembly. The first rotating block 16 rotates in the direction of the extrusion assembly, so that the first rotating block 16 pulls the first spring 15. When the pressing assembly is released, the first spring 15 will quickly drive the first rotating block 16 to reset, thereby sealing the transfer pipe 17 and preventing excessive lubricant from flowing out. This not only provides lubrication for the guide post 3, but also saves resources to a certain extent.
[0030] In one embodiment, the guide groove 4 is provided in two sets and is symmetrically arranged, and the guide groove 4 is slidably connected to the guide post 3.
[0031] The working principle of the precision mold guiding device proposed in this utility model is that two sets of symmetrically arranged guide grooves 4 provide stability for the fit between the upper module 1 and the lower module 2, and the sliding connection between the guide post 3 and the guide groove 4 further improves the stability between the upper module 1 and the lower module 2, effectively improving the quality of the product.
[0032] In one embodiment, the extrusion assembly includes an extrusion plug 11 slidably mounted on the guide groove 4, one end of an extrusion spring 13 is fixedly connected above the extrusion plug 11, and the other end of the extrusion spring 13 is fixedly mounted on the lower surface of the slider 14.
[0033] In one embodiment, for the guide groove 4, a sliding groove 12 is symmetrically provided inside the guide groove 4, and a slider 14 is slidably connected to the sliding groove 12.
[0034] The working principle of the guide device for precision mold proposed in this utility model is as follows: when the pressure on the upper module 1 is released, the compression spring 13 will push the slider 14 to slide stably in the slide groove 12. At the same time, the compression spring 13 will also pull the compression plug 11 to move upward, so that the space of the cavity 10 returns to its original size, preparing for the next molding, thus improving the overall working efficiency of the device.
[0035] In one embodiment, the second control component includes a second rotating plate 8 rotatably mounted on the oil injection pipe 9, one end of the second rotating plate 8 being fixedly connected to a second spring 7, and the other end of the second spring 7 being fixedly mounted on the inner wall of the oil injection pipe 9.
[0036] In one embodiment, for the oil injection pipe 9, the end of the oil injection pipe 9 away from the extrusion assembly is connected to the oil storage chamber 18, and the oil injection pipe 9 is inclined and the end near the oil storage chamber 18 is lower.
[0037] In one embodiment, for the upper module 1 described above, an oil tank door 6 is provided on the side of the upper module 1, and an oil storage chamber 18 is provided on the back of the oil tank door 6.
[0038] The working principle of the precision mold guiding device proposed in this utility model is as follows: when the upper module 1 presses the lower module 2 close together, the airflow in the cavity 10 will squeeze the second rotating plate 8, the second rotating plate 8 will pull the second spring 7, and the oil injection pipe 9 will be opened. Due to the gravity of the lubricant itself, there is a force on the second rotating plate in the direction of the pressing component, thereby avoiding the problem of excessive rotation of the second rotating plate and avoiding excessive flow of lubricant. The lubricant in the oil storage cavity 18 will smoothly enter the cavity 10 along the extension direction of the oil injection pipe 9, and replenish the missing lubricant in the cavity 10 in time.
[0039] It is worth noting that when the lubricant needs to be replenished, simply open the oil reservoir door 6 to replenish the lubricant in the oil storage chamber 18.
